zoukankan      html  css  js  c++  java
  • ftp自动登录的几种方式

    1.#!/bin/bash
    ftp -n <<!
    open 10.128.250.130
    user ftpuser guankou-vds
    ls
    put 123.gz
    cd ..
    ls
    bye
    !

    在脚本里面执行正常。

    链接 http://www.cnblogs.com/ggjucheng/archive/2012/05/09/2491248.html

    2.利用~/.netrc文件,

    [root@localhost feng]# cat ~/.netrc
    machine 10.128.250.130 login ftpuser password guankou-vds

    建立一个命令文件:

    cat ftp_cmd_file

    cd /home/data
    lcd /home/databackup
    prompt
    put a.sh a.sh
    close
    bye

    然后可以执行命令:

    ftp 192.168.0.82 << ftp_cmd_file 就可以实现自动登录并执行命令。

    如果不想引用外部的命令文件,可以在.netrc文件中定义一个宏,并以空行结束,即可实现自动登录执行命令。

    machine 192.168.0.82 login abc password abc123
    macdef init
     binary
     bell
     hash
     prompt
     !clear
     mget *
     !clear
     bye

    链接 http://blog.csdn.net/mpiceer/article/details/3854491

  • 相关阅读:
    解决maven无法下载jar的问题
    Vue-Router 基础
    VUE自定义组件
    VUE过滤器
    VUE生命周期函数
    VUE表单输入绑定
    VUE计算属性和监听器
    VUE 模板语法
    VUE介绍
    taro3.x: 函数组件createIntersectionObserver
  • 原文地址:https://www.cnblogs.com/mycats/p/3937853.html
Copyright © 2011-2022 走看看